[發(fā)明專利]一種服務(wù)API調(diào)用方法和相關(guān)裝置在審
| 申請?zhí)枺?/td> | 201810312734.1 | 申請日: | 2018-04-09 |
| 公開(公告)號: | CN110362412A | 公開(公告)日: | 2019-10-22 |
| 發(fā)明(設(shè)計(jì))人: | 王勇;潘凱;葛翠麗;陳璟 | 申請(專利權(quán))人: | 華為技術(shù)有限公司 |
| 主分類號: | G06F9/54 | 分類號: | G06F9/54;G06F21/54 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 518129 廣東*** | 國省代碼: | 廣東;44 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 調(diào)用 功能實(shí)體 服務(wù)API 調(diào)用請求 安全 開放 服務(wù)應(yīng)用程序 通信技術(shù)領(lǐng)域 編程接口 方法更新 相關(guān)裝置 申請 匹配 發(fā)送 失敗 通信 應(yīng)用 | ||
本申請實(shí)施例涉及通信技術(shù)領(lǐng)域,提供一種服務(wù)應(yīng)用程序編程接口API的調(diào)用方法,應(yīng)用于API開放功能實(shí)體的安全方法由舊的安全方法更新為新的安全方法,其中,所述API開放功能實(shí)體的安全方法用于所述API開放功能實(shí)體與調(diào)用者之間通信,所述方法包括:所述調(diào)用者獲取所述API開放功能實(shí)體的新的安全方法;所述調(diào)用者使用所述新的安全方法向所述API開放功能實(shí)體發(fā)送第一調(diào)用請求,所述第一調(diào)用請求包括服務(wù)API的名稱,所述第一調(diào)用請求用于調(diào)用所述服務(wù)API。通過本申請實(shí)施例的方案,可以避免由于安全方法不匹配導(dǎo)致服務(wù)API調(diào)用失敗。
技術(shù)領(lǐng)域
本申請涉及通信技術(shù)領(lǐng)域,尤其涉及一種服務(wù)API調(diào)用方法和相關(guān)裝置。
背景技術(shù)
第三代合作伙伴計(jì)劃(3rd Generation Partnership Project,3GPP)定義了多種北向應(yīng)用程序編程接口(application programming interface,API)相關(guān)的規(guī)范。為了避免不同API規(guī)范之間的重復(fù)和不一致,3GPP考慮開發(fā)一個(gè)通用的API框架(common APIframework,CAPIF),其包含適用于所有北向API的通用特性。其中,CAPIF一般部署在運(yùn)營商網(wǎng)絡(luò)內(nèi)。
圖1為基于CAPIF的架構(gòu)示意圖。圖1所示的架構(gòu)中主要包括以下網(wǎng)元:
API調(diào)用者(API invoker),通常由和運(yùn)營商網(wǎng)絡(luò)有服務(wù)協(xié)議的第三方應(yīng)用提供商提供。
服務(wù)API(service API),為給API invoker提供服務(wù)的接口。
CAPIF核心功能(CAPIF core function)實(shí)體,為service API所有策略的中央存儲器,也是API invoker和service API認(rèn)證與授權(quán)的中心。
CAPIF API,為給API invoker提供CAPIF core function實(shí)體入口的接口。
API開放功能(API exposing function,AEF)實(shí)體,為服務(wù)提供方對外開放服務(wù)的一個(gè)入口,API invoker通過AEF實(shí)體可以使用服務(wù)提供方提供的服務(wù)。
API公布功能(API publishing function)實(shí)體,可以將service API的信息公布到CAPIF core function實(shí)體,以便API invoker在CAPIF core function實(shí)體找到serviceAPI的信息。
API管理功能(API management function)實(shí)體,執(zhí)行對service API的管理,例如監(jiān)控service API的狀態(tài),記錄調(diào)用信息等。
圖1中,公共陸地移動網(wǎng)信任域(public land mobile network trust domain,PLMN trust domain)表示一個(gè)公用陸地移動網(wǎng)所信任的區(qū)域。API提供者域(API providerdomain)表示API提供者所在的一個(gè)區(qū)域。
其中,上述各網(wǎng)元之間的連接關(guān)系如下:
PLMN信任域外的API調(diào)用者與CAPIF core function實(shí)體之間的接口為CAPIF-1e接口,與AEF實(shí)體之間的接口為CAPIF-2e接口。PLMN信任域內(nèi)的API調(diào)用者與CAPIF corefunction實(shí)體之間的接口為CAPIF-1接口,與AEF實(shí)體之間的接口為CAPIF-2接口。CAPIFcore function實(shí)體與AEF實(shí)體之間的接口為CAPIF-3接口,與API公布功能實(shí)體之間的接口為CAPIF-4接口,與API管理功能之間的接口為CAPIF-5接口。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于華為技術(shù)有限公司,未經(jīng)華為技術(shù)有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810312734.1/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- IDL調(diào)用裝置及調(diào)用方法
- 調(diào)用方法及調(diào)用系統(tǒng)
- 一種服務(wù)調(diào)用方法及裝置
- 服務(wù)調(diào)用方法、服務(wù)調(diào)用裝置及服務(wù)調(diào)用系統(tǒng)
- 組件調(diào)用方法、裝置及計(jì)算機(jī)可讀存儲介質(zhì)
- 身份驗(yàn)證方法及裝置
- 系統(tǒng)調(diào)用處理方法、裝置、計(jì)算機(jī)設(shè)備和存儲介質(zhì)
- 一種數(shù)據(jù)調(diào)用方法、裝置、電子設(shè)備及存儲介質(zhì)
- 一種微服務(wù)請求重試的方法及終端
- 業(yè)務(wù)數(shù)據(jù)的處理方法、裝置及系統(tǒng)
- 一種WiMAX網(wǎng)絡(luò)中功能實(shí)體的遷移方法
- 實(shí)現(xiàn)媒體交付控制的方法、實(shí)體及系統(tǒng)
- IPTV網(wǎng)絡(luò)互連架構(gòu)及互連方法
- 無線鏈路控制功能實(shí)體及其處理數(shù)據(jù)的方法
- 一種無線鏈路控制功能實(shí)體及其處理數(shù)據(jù)的方法
- 一種消息傳輸方法及裝置
- 網(wǎng)絡(luò)控制的方法和裝置以及通信系統(tǒng)
- 計(jì)費(fèi)實(shí)現(xiàn)系統(tǒng)、計(jì)費(fèi)實(shí)現(xiàn)方法及計(jì)費(fèi)管理功能實(shí)體
- 一種會話管理方法及裝置
- 一種通信方法、裝置、實(shí)體及存儲介質(zhì)
- 一種獲取API服務(wù)的方法及系統(tǒng)
- 一種基于RESTful的服務(wù)處理方法、裝置及系統(tǒng)
- 在傳輸層對API服務(wù)數(shù)據(jù)進(jìn)行加解密的方法及系統(tǒng)
- 一種基于終端類型配置API資源的方法及系統(tǒng)
- API服務(wù)的訪問方法、裝置及電子設(shè)備
- 在線接口調(diào)試平臺
- 一種用于服務(wù)器端上API接口的過載保護(hù)裝置
- 下一代網(wǎng)絡(luò)中的通用API框架所用的安全過程
- 一種應(yīng)用程序接口API管理的方法以及相關(guān)裝置
- 一種API資源管理方法、設(shè)備及介質(zhì)
- 優(yōu)化系統(tǒng)調(diào)用請求通信
- 一種提供網(wǎng)絡(luò)服務(wù)的方法和系統(tǒng)
- 推遲對遠(yuǎn)程對象的調(diào)用請求
- 節(jié)點(diǎn)調(diào)用鏈路生成方法、裝置、計(jì)算機(jī)設(shè)備及存儲介質(zhì)
- 終端中敏感權(quán)限模塊的調(diào)用請求的處理方法及裝置
- 日志信息處理方法、裝置、電子設(shè)備及可讀存儲介質(zhì)
- 傳輸調(diào)用消息的方法和系統(tǒng)、轉(zhuǎn)發(fā)服務(wù)器及可讀存儲介質(zhì)
- 服務(wù)調(diào)用的處理方法、裝置、電子設(shè)備及可讀存儲介質(zhì)
- 組件調(diào)用方法、裝置及計(jì)算機(jī)可讀存儲介質(zhì)
- 調(diào)用請求的處理方法、裝置和計(jì)算機(jī)存儲介質(zhì)





